Fred and the bedtime elephants / Caroline Crowe ; pictures by Claudia Ranucci.
"When Fred can't sleep, his mom suggests counting sheep. But sheep are boring, so Fred tries to count elephants instead. Soon the elephants are wreaking havoc on his whole house, and Fred has to find a way to get rid of them, or he'll never go to sleep"--Provided by publisher.

Caroline Crowe spent ten years as a national newspaper journalist and section editor. She is the author of Pirates in Pyjamas and Tiny Tantrum. She lives in the UK with her three sons and husband. Claudia Ranucci lives in Madrid, Spain. She graduated in Graphic Design and Illustration at the Istituto Superiore Industrie Artisitche (ISIA) in Italy.
